Barack Obama bids farewell to Tanzania as Africa trip comes to an end
Barack Obama, the US President, bade farewell to Tanzania, wrapping up his three-country tour of Africa with a game of "Soccket ball" in Dar-es-Salaam. The hi-tech ball, which contains a battery, stores up enough energy during play to power a phone or small lamp.
Mr Obama also laid a wreath for victims of the 1998 bombing at the US Embassy in Tanzania, with the former President George W Bush, who by chance was in Tanzania for a conference on women's roles in Africa.
